Apes get iPads at National Zoo
Published January 23, 2013
LiveScience
The Smithsonian zoo is giving a new iPad to each orangutan at the zoo. There are some games that the orangutans prefer over others. "36-year-old Bonnie likes to hit the drums, 16-year-old Kyle likes to play the piano, and 25-year-old Iris likes watching animated fish swim in a virtual koi pond on the screen."
